net.minecraft.world.level.biome

public final class Biome

cnf
net.minecraft.world.level.biome.Biome
net.minecraft.class_1959
net.minecraft.unmapped.C_orlkpefs
net.minecraft.world.biome.Biome
net.minecraft.world.biome.Biome
net.minecraft.src.C_1629_
net.minecraft.world.level.biome.BiomeBase

Field summary

Modifier and TypeField
public static final com.mojang.serialization.Codec<Biome>
a
DIRECT_CODEC
field_25819
f_zrstnwal
CODEC
CODEC
f_47429_
public static final com.mojang.serialization.Codec<Biome>
b
NETWORK_CODEC
field_26633
f_tmydiaps
NETWORK_CODEC
NETWORK_CODEC
f_47430_
public static final com.mojang.serialization.Codec<Holder<Biome>>
c
CODEC
field_24677
f_hqebeqks
REGISTRY_CODEC
REGISTRY_CODEC
f_47431_
public static final com.mojang.serialization.Codec<HolderSet<Biome>>
d
LIST_CODEC
field_26750
f_xhmqxraz
REGISTRY_ENTRY_LIST_CODEC
LIST_CODEC
f_47432_
private static final PerlinSimplexNoise
f
TEMPERATURE_NOISE
field_9335
f_oksshdkm
TEMPERATURE_NOISE
TEMPERATURE_NOISE
f_47435_
static final PerlinSimplexNoise
g
FROZEN_TEMPERATURE_NOISE
field_26392
f_hrzrnybt
FROZEN_OCEAN_NOISE
FROZEN_OCEAN_NOISE
f_47436_
public static final PerlinSimplexNoise
e
BIOME_INFO_NOISE
field_9324
f_fakqbtie
FOLIAGE_NOISE
FOLIAGE_NOISE
f_47433_
private static final int
h
TEMPERATURE_CACHE_SIZE
field_30978
f_esosqcia
MAX_TEMPERATURE_CACHE_SIZE
TEMPERATURE_CACHE_SIZE
f_151655_
private final Biome$ClimateSettings
i
climateSettings
field_26393
f_nkpjdtli
weather
weather
f_47437_
private final BiomeGenerationSettings
j
generationSettings
field_26635
f_oenvqmji
generationSettings
generationSettings
f_47438_
private final MobSpawnSettings
k
mobSettings
field_26395
f_kngqmtpv
spawnSettings
spawnSettings
f_47439_
private final BiomeSpecialEffects
l
specialEffects
field_22039
f_qudszlsg
effects
effects
f_47443_
private final ThreadLocal<it.unimi.dsi.fastutil.longs.Long2FloatLinkedOpenHashMap>
m
temperatureCache
field_20335
f_yczodbxb
temperatureCache
temperatureCache
f_47444_

Constructor summary

ModifierConstructor
(Biome$ClimateSettings weather, BiomeSpecialEffects effects, BiomeGenerationSettings generationSettings, MobSpawnSettings spawnSettings)

Method summary

Modifier and TypeMethod
public int
a()
getSkyColor()
method_8697()
m_sfuutlab()
getSkyColor()
getSkyColor()
m_47463_()
public MobSpawnSettings
b()
getMobSettings()
method_30966()
m_sovebmbx()
getSpawnSettings()
getSpawnSettings()
m_47518_()
public boolean
c()
hasPrecipitation()
method_48163()
m_cgvmxqgd()
hasPrecipitation()
hasPrecipitation()
m_264473_()
public Biome$Precipitation
a(gt arg0)
getPrecipitationAt(BlockPos arg0)
method_48162(class_2338 arg0)
m_kfrabqcq(C_hynzadkk arg0)
getPrecipitation(BlockPos pos)
getPrecipitationAt(BlockPos pos)
m_264600_(C_4675_ arg0)
private float
e(gt arg0)
getHeightAdjustedTemperature(BlockPos arg0)
method_8707(class_2338 arg0)
m_gdqwjlfa(C_hynzadkk arg0)
computeTemperature(BlockPos pos)
computeTemperature(BlockPos pos)
m_47528_(C_4675_ arg0)
private float
f(gt arg0)
getTemperature(BlockPos arg0)
method_21740(class_2338 arg0)
m_bxcqopci(C_hynzadkk arg0)
getTemperature(BlockPos blockPos)
getTemperature(BlockPos blockPos)
m_47505_(C_4675_ arg0)
public boolean
a(cml arg0, gt arg1)
shouldFreeze(LevelReader arg0, BlockPos arg1)
method_8705(class_4538 arg0, class_2338 arg1)
m_djiywayc(C_eemzphbi arg0, C_hynzadkk arg1)
canSetIce(WorldView world, BlockPos blockPos)
canSetIce(WorldView world, BlockPos blockPos)
m_47477_(C_1599_ p_47479_, C_4675_ arg1)
public boolean
a(cml arg0, gt arg1, boolean arg2)
shouldFreeze(LevelReader arg0, BlockPos arg1, boolean arg2)
method_8685(class_4538 arg0, class_2338 arg1, boolean arg2)
m_vbqsdlwy(C_eemzphbi arg0, C_hynzadkk arg1, boolean arg2)
canSetIce(WorldView world, BlockPos pos, boolean doWaterCheck)
canSetIce(WorldView world, BlockPos pos, boolean doWaterCheck)
m_47480_(C_1599_ p_47482_, C_4675_ p_47483_, boolean arg2)
public boolean
b(gt arg0)
coldEnoughToSnow(BlockPos arg0)
method_33599(class_2338 arg0)
m_lmfmdeyy(C_hynzadkk arg0)
isCold(BlockPos pos)
isColdEnoughToSnow(BlockPos pos)
m_198904_(C_4675_ arg0)
public boolean
c(gt arg0)
warmEnoughToRain(BlockPos arg0)
method_39927(class_2338 arg0)
m_osufipcg(C_hynzadkk arg0)
doesNotSnow(BlockPos pos)
doesNotSnow(BlockPos pos)
m_198906_(C_4675_ arg0)
public boolean
d(gt arg0)
shouldMeltFrozenOceanIcebergSlightly(BlockPos arg0)
method_39928(class_2338 arg0)
m_ehtcmull(C_hynzadkk arg0)
shouldGenerateLowerFrozenOceanSurface(BlockPos pos)
shouldMeltFrozenOceanIcebergsSlightly(BlockPos pos)
m_198908_(C_4675_ arg0)
public boolean
b(cml arg0, gt arg1)
shouldSnow(LevelReader arg0, BlockPos arg1)
method_8696(class_4538 arg0, class_2338 arg1)
m_ceymkdve(C_eemzphbi arg0, C_hynzadkk arg1)
canSetSnow(WorldView world, BlockPos pos)
canSetSnow(WorldView world, BlockPos blockPos)
m_47519_(C_1599_ p_47521_, C_4675_ arg1)
public BiomeGenerationSettings
d()
getGenerationSettings()
method_30970()
m_kspyocvf()
getGenerationSettings()
getGenerationSettings()
m_47536_()
public int
e()
getFogColor()
method_24376()
m_hwnmdrhy()
getFogColor()
getFogColor()
m_47539_()
public int
a(double arg0, double arg1)
getGrassColor(double arg0, double arg1)
method_8711(double arg0, double arg1)
m_ixrstays(double arg0, double arg1)
getGrassColorAt(double x, double z)
getGrassColorAt(double x, double z)
m_47464_(double p_47466_, double arg1)
private int
p()
getGrassColorFromTexture()
method_30773()
m_fzluldde()
getDefaultGrassColor()
getDefaultGrassColor()
m_47570_()
public int
f()
getFoliageColor()
method_8698()
m_pnqwvygb()
getFoliageColor()
getFoliageColor()
m_47542_()
private int
q()
getFoliageColorFromTexture()
method_30774()
m_zexssfli()
getDefaultFoliageColor()
getDefaultFoliageColor()
m_47571_()
public float
g()
getBaseTemperature()
method_8712()
m_ktofobbo()
getTemperature()
getTemperature()
m_47554_()
public BiomeSpecialEffects
h()
getSpecialEffects()
method_24377()
m_eeqbuytj()
getEffects()
getEffects()
m_47557_()
public int
i()
getWaterColor()
method_8687()
m_owlcweyv()
getWaterColor()
getWaterColor()
m_47560_()
public int
j()
getWaterFogColor()
method_8713()
m_odukezkb()
getWaterFogColor()
getWaterFogColor()
m_47561_()
public Optional<AmbientParticleSettings>
k()
getAmbientParticle()
method_24378()
m_rhomhsku()
getParticleConfig()
getParticleConfig()
m_47562_()
public Optional<Holder<SoundEvent>>
l()
getAmbientLoop()
method_24935()
m_nkfekxcm()
getLoopSound()
getLoopSound()
m_47563_()
public Optional<AmbientMoodSettings>
m()
getAmbientMood()
method_24936()
m_fijxsubt()
getMoodSound()
getMoodSound()
m_47564_()
public Optional<AmbientAdditionsSettings>
n()
getAmbientAdditions()
method_24937()
m_jaxultdc()
getAdditionsSound()
getAdditionsSound()
m_47565_()
public Optional<Music>
o()
getBackgroundMusic()
method_27343()
m_sipbqfgi()
getMusic()
getMusic()
m_47566_()